Drowning is fast, silent, and often unnoticed.
π Always supervise. Kids can lose consciousness in just 30 seconds.
π€« Drowning doesnβt look like the movies. Thereβs usually no splashing or cries for help.
π Designate a water watcher. Donβt assume someone else is watching.
